I developed my understanding of the corporate environment in a range of fast-moving service industries with high profile clients. After experience in line management, I became an HR Manager for a leading hotel group, then a Marketing Manager, a National Account Manager, and a Manager of Learning & Development for American Express - a high intensity crucible for learning that set me in good stead for becoming the coach I am today.
Since becoming an independent consultant, coach and facilitator over 15 years ago, I have worked with executives, and senior managers in private, public and voluntary sectors including multi-cultural organisations. I've also launched and ran a successful learning and development consultancy with my business partner, Ian Mackenzie. I am now also working as a coach supervisor to many professional coaches and have set up a number of coach supervision groups. I benefit from regular supervision and maintain an active CPD leaning journal, to sustain my accreditation.
I regularly work in the related areas of Leadership, Change, Performance Management, and Communication Skills, and use real scenarios in workshops whenever possible, and work with actors when appropriate.
